Cost of Electrical Line Trenching in Tallahassee

When planning to install or upgrade electrical lines in Tallahassee, FL, one of the primary considerations is the cost of trenching. Trenching involves digging a narrow excavation in the ground to lay down electrical cables, which can vary significantly based on several factors. Understanding these factors can help homeowners and businesses budget effectively for their electrical projects.

Factors Affecting Cost

  • Soil Type: The type of soil in Tallahassee, whether it's sandy, clay, or rocky, can impact the ease of trenching and, consequently, the cost.
  • Trench Depth and Length: Deeper and longer trenches require more labor and materials, increasing the overall cost.
  • Permits and Regulations: Local regulations and the need for permits in Tallahassee can add to the cost, as compliance with city codes is mandatory.
  • Obstacles and Terrain: The presence of natural or man-made obstacles, such as tree roots or existing utilities, can complicate the trenching process and raise costs.
  • Labor Rates: Local labor rates in Tallahassee can influence the cost, with experienced contractors charging more for their expertise.
  • Equipment Rental: The need for specialized trenching equipment, which may need to be rented, can also add to the expenses.

Average Costs for Common Tasks

Task Average Cost (Tallahassee, FL)
Basic Trenching (per linear foot) $8 - $15
Trenching in Rocky Soil (per linear foot) $15 - $25
Permits and Inspection Fees $100 - $300
Laying Electrical Conduits $2 - $4 per foot
Backfilling and Compaction $1 - $3 per foot
Total Cost for 100-foot Trench $1,100 - $2,700
